Abstract
The utility model discloses an electricity-saving mobile phone, which comprises a mobile phone housing, LCD illumination components, keyboard illumination keys and a mobile phone main board circuit, wherein conductors are used to make the connection between the LCD illumination components, and the keyboard illumination keys and the illumination output of the mobile phone main board circuit, the mobile phone housing is provided with a light sensing hole, a photosensitive component is arranged in the light sensing hole, the photosensitive component forms a photosensitive switch that is connected into the illumination output of the mobile phone main board circuit in series. The utility model can save energy consumption of battery for mobile phone effectively, thereby reducing charge times of battery for mobile phone and increasing service life of battery. The utility model has strong practicality, electricity saving and is easy to be popularized for application.
Description
Technical field
The utility model relates to a kind of Power saving hand phone.
Background technology
Existing various mobile phone is being transferred to signal, received signal and is being pressed under the situation such as keyboard, and LCDs illumination component and keyboard illumination button all can be luminous automatically.This design designs in order to use when under dark surrounds originally, but actual conditions are, most people by day or the probability of under enough bright environment, using than higher.Thus, it is unreasonable that above-mentioned design just seems, no matter because when using under what environment, all allow illumination component work a period of time, this will exhaust certain electric energy in vain, thereby has shortened the service time of the each charging of battery of mobile phone, has brought inconvenience for user's use.
The utility model content
The purpose of this utility model is to provide a kind of Power saving hand phone.
In order to achieve the above object, the technical solution of the utility model is to have adopted a kind of Power saving hand phone, comprise handset shell, LCDs illumination component, keyboard illumination button and cell phone mainboard circuit, link to each other with lead between LCDs illumination component, keyboard illumination button and the cell phone mainboard circuit illumination output, handset shell is provided with a photographic hole, one light-sensitive element is arranged in the photographic hole, and light-sensitive element constitutes photosensitive switch and seals in the cell phone mainboard circuit illumination output.
Because handset shell is provided with a photographic hole, one light-sensitive element is arranged in the photographic hole, light-sensitive element constitutes photosensitive switch and seals in the cell phone mainboard circuit illumination output, when in case ambient light is enough bright, this photosensitive switch is with regard to automatic shutdown circuit, and LCDs illumination component and keyboard illumination button are not just worked, and can save the consumption of battery of mobile phone so effectively, thereby reduced charging times, increased the useful life of battery battery of mobile phone.Mobile phone of the present utility model is practical, power saving, be easy to apply.
Description of drawings
Fig. 1 is a structural representation of the present utility model;
Fig. 2 is a circuit connecting relation schematic diagram of the present utility model.
Embodiment
Power saving hand phone as shown in Figure 1 is equipped with a photodiode D in the photographic hole at handset shell 1 top, LCDs is provided with LCDs illumination component 2 and keyboard illumination button 3.
As shown in Figure 2, the illumination output of cell phone mainboard circuit 4 links to each other with keyboard illumination button 3 with LCDs illumination component 2 respectively by lead, string has photosensitive switch K in the illumination output of cell phone mainboard circuit 4, and photosensitive switch K is that light-sensitive element constitutes with photodiode D.When ambient light was enough bright, photosensitive switch K just can automatic disconnection.
